WITNESS PROTECTION ACT 2000 - SECT 47

Special provision about minors and adults with impaired capacity

47 Special provision about minors and adults with impaired capacity

(1) This section applies to a notice, agreement, acknowledgement or another document to be signed by a protected witness who is a minor or a person with impaired capacity.
(2) A document to be signed by a minor may be signed by a parent or guardian of the minor.
(3) A document to be signed by an adult with impaired capacity may be signed by—
(a) a person who may exercise powers in relation to personal matters for the adult under a power of attorney under the Powers of Attorney Act 1998 ; or
(b) a guardian of the adult under the Guardianship and Administration Act 2000 .
